Syracuse's sports-card headquarters for sealed wax, slabs, and live group breaks — the shop behind the city's Topps Rip Night events.
GG Cards & Breaks grew out of Gideon's Gallery as a dedicated sports-card operation, and it has quickly become the anchor of the Syracuse hobby scene. The Delmar Place shop stocks the full modern pipeline — sealed hobby boxes, singles, slabs, and supplies — while running the online group breaks that gave the store the second half of its name. If you want to rip live with other collectors rather than alone at your kitchen table, this is the room where that happens in Central New York.
Owners Josh Gideon and Anthony Campbell have leaned hard into community events, most visibly the store's Topps Rip Night appearances that drew coverage from Sports Collectors Digest — including a visit tied to Syracuse basketball's Kiyan Anthony. That connection to Orange fandom matters here: local college and pro rookies move fast, and the display cases reflect what Syracuse actually collects. Beyond sports, the shop carries Yu-Gi-Oh!, Dragon Ball Super, and Flesh and Blood product for crossover collectors.
At 4.7 stars across more than 50 Google reviews, the buy counter earns most of the praise — regulars describe Josh and the staff as the reason they keep coming back to this Syracuse card shop. As with any store that buys collections, bring realistic expectations on bulk-value cards; sellers with graded modern hits report the smoothest transactions.
Hours are steady and collector-friendly: 10AM to 6PM Tuesday through Saturday and 10AM to 5PM Sunday, closed Monday. The shop sits on Delmar Place off Court Street on the city's north side with parking at the door, and the active Instagram is the best place to catch break schedules before slots fill.
